摘要
A three dimensional numerical investigation of a commercial four-ply paperboard formed into a pear-shaped mould was presented. The numerical investigation included the effect of pressure, boundary conditions, material properties and different deformation and damage mechanisms such as delamination and plasticity. Simulations were done in both the MD and CD using different pressures. A paperboard model with a combination of anisotropic continuum model and a softening interface model had good deformation behavior during the forming simulations. Forming experiment that mimicked the simulations was performed. Numerical and experiment results were compared with good agreement.
